Question: I cannot sleep when I need to be asleep and I basically pass out when I should be awake. How do I stop this crazy cycle?

Go to sleep & wake up the same time every day.
Use your bedroom only for sleep & intimacy.

Begin a consistent bedtime routine that is calming. Take a hot bath, drink chamomile tea. Take passionflower, valerian root, catnip, lavender spray (all good for sleeping.) Don't exercise less than 3 hrs. before bedtime.

If you can't fall asleep after 20 min.; get out of bed & read something boring, watch TV, etc...when you start to feel tired try going to sleep again. Repeat if necessary.
DO NOT look at clocks during night, it will just get you more anxious about not sleeping.

I had the same problem when I started working my 12 hour night shift job. You have to force yourself to stay up longer and longer gradually during the times you are supposed to be awake. When you are exhausted during your supposed "wake cycle", set your alarm for a set period of time, and take a nap. When you are supposed to sleep, eliminate stimulants 2-3 hours before going to bed. Follow a regular routine before going to bed. Decide what time is bedtime for you, and stick to it. If you wake up early, don't give up. It takes a while to get your sleep pattern changed.
